Shire Horses: Their Preferred Environments

Shire horses are massive breeds originally from the British Isles. They've been employed for ages in rural work, and their choice for certain habitats shows their historical roles.

Shire horses generally flourish in fertile areas with plenty of get more info space to roam. They require access to fresh water and nutritious forage. Pastures with a mix of grasses are ideal for these docile giants.

They sometimes prefer to be in regions that are relatively level as their size can make navigating rough terrain difficult. A good shelter from the elements is also essential, especially during harsh weather.

From Pastures to Fields: Exploring Shire Horse Territories

The Shire horse, a famous breed known for its towering stature and gentle nature, inhabits the British Isles for centuries. These strong creatures have long been linked to agricultural life, working pastures with their might.

Contemporary Shire horses still play a role this heritage, often seen pulling carriages at festivals and events, or simply enjoying the sunshine in pastures. Their unique appearance, with their thick manes and tails, and their gentle temperament, make them a favorite sight wherever they go.
